Personal Information
Name: John Disley
Gender: Male
Born: 1st Jan 1816
Death: 21st May 1882
Age at death: 66
Occupation: Farm labourer & ploughman
Crime
Crime: Obtaining by false pretences
Convicted at: Lancaster Quarter Sessions
Sentence term: 7 years
Voyage
Departed: 28th Feb 1851
Ship: Cornwall
Arrival: 11th Jun 1851
Place of Arrival: Van Diemen's Land
Transportation
John Disley was transported on the Cornwall, departing 28th Feb 1851 and arriving 11th Jun 1851 with 300 passengers.

Convict Notes


338


338
Place of origin: Preston, Lancashire Offence; Stealing groceries under false pretenses. Trade; Farm Labourer. Height; 5 ft 5 inches aged 34 years old 1879 - Health & Welfare Name; Robert Disley*** Ship to colony: Cornwall Brickfields Invalid Depot: POL709-1-17 page 63 (30 May 1879 to 09 Apr 1880) - LEFT with-out permission. 1882 - Death; 21 May 1882. RGD35/1/10 no 192 Name; Robert Disley/Desley *** Died Brickfields Pauper Establishment aged 68 years old, Labourer
